Hasn’t been confirmed anywhere else that I have seen….
Randy Johnson has agreed to a one-year deal with the San Francisco Giants, FOXSports.com has learned.
Johnson, 45, needs just five wins to reach 300. He’s also chasing 5,000 strikeouts, entering the season with 4,789.
After an injury-plagued 2007, Johnson bounced back last season to throw 184 innings with a 3.91 ERA for the Diamondbacks.
Johnson joins a San Francisco rotation that already includes 2008 Cy Young winner Tim Lincecum, Matt Cain and Barry Zito.
The Dodgers were also interested in Johnson, who preferred to stay on the West Coast while playing for a team that holds spring training in Arizona.
The deal is expected to be announced Friday night.

by my count, the 2010 salary situation currently sits about about $52 million. Several big contracts come off the books after 2009:
Winn: $8.5m
Johnson: $8m
Roberts: $6.5m
Molina: $6m
Lowry: $4.5m
Howry: $2.75m
Total: $36M
Cain’s salary increases by $1.6m to $4.25m, so that’s still a net (with raises, if any, aside) of $34.4m coming off the books in 2010.
